5 Project Coding Seru yang Bisa Kamu Coba Pas Lagi Gabut

Ilustrasi Gambar: 5 Project Coding Seru yang Bisa Kamu Coba Pas Lagi Gabut.

Pernah nggak sih kamu lagi bengong, nggak tahu mau ngapain, tapi merasa pengen ngoding biar otak tetap aktif? Atau mungkin kamu lagi belajar coding dan butuh project seru buat latihan? Tenang, kamu nggak sendirian. Banyak kok programmer yang mengalami “gabut produktif” kayak gitu.

Daripada scroll TikTok berjam-jam atau binge-watching drama Korea sampai lupa waktu, mending kamu manfaatin waktu luangmu buat bikin project coding yang ringan tapi tetap menantang. Selain bikin skill kamu makin tajam, siapa tahu bisa jadi portofolio juga, ya kan?Berikut ini 5 project coding seru yang bisa kamu coba pas lagi gabut. Nggak butuh alat canggih kok—laptop, text editor, dan secangkir kopi udah cukup. Yuk, kita mulai!

1. To-Do List App: Bikin yang Sederhana Tapi Estetik

Yup, project klasik ini nggak pernah ketinggalan zaman. To-Do List bisa kamu buat dengan HTML, CSS, dan JavaScript doang. Tapi biar makin seru, coba kamu tambahkan fitur-fitur seperti:

  • Mode dark/light
  • Filter tugas berdasarkan status (selesai/belum)
  • Penyimpanan lokal dengan localStorage
  • Drag & drop untuk urutan tugas

Selain buat latihan logika, kamu juga bisa belajar UI/UX dari project ini. Gunakan Tailwind CSS atau Bootstrap biar tampilannya nggak kaku. Kalau udah selesai, coba deploy di GitHub Pages atau Vercel. Simple tapi keren!

2. Aplikasi Kalkulator Sederhana (dengan Tema Kustom)

Kalkulator? Kedengarannya basic banget ya? Tapi jangan salah! Justru project ini cocok banget buat kamu yang baru belajar DOM manipulation di JavaScript.

Coba bikin kalkulator yang bisa:

  • Melakukan operasi dasar (tambah, kurang, kali, bagi)
  • Menghapus satu karakter (backspace)
  • Mengganti tema (dark, neon, retro, dll.)
  • Menampilkan riwayat perhitungan

Kalau kamu pengen upgrade, tambahkan keyboard support dan animasi transisi antar tema. Kamu bisa juga tambahkan suara tombol untuk efek yang lebih interaktif.

3. Website Portofolio Pribadi

Gabut? Saatnya bikin website portofolio! Ini salah satu investasi terbaik buat masa depanmu sebagai developer. Project ini bisa jadi latihan frontend sekaligus alat promosi dirimu.

Beberapa hal yang bisa kamu masukkan ke dalam portofoliomu:

  • Profil singkat dan foto
  • Daftar project yang pernah kamu buat
  • Link ke GitHub, LinkedIn, atau blog pribadi
  • Formulir kontak yang terhubung ke email kamu

Gunakan animasi ringan dengan CSS atau library seperti AOS (Animate On Scroll). Kalau mau tampil beda, coba buat versi dark mode atau tambahkan audio background yang bisa diaktifkan user.

4. Aplikasi Cuaca Real-Time

Dengan bantuan API seperti OpenWeatherMap, kamu bisa bikin aplikasi yang menampilkan info cuaca berdasarkan lokasi user. Ini tantangan seru karena kamu belajar cara kerja API, JSON, dan geolokasi browser.

Fitur yang bisa kamu tambahkan:

  • Input nama kota
  • Deteksi otomatis lokasi pengguna
  • Menampilkan suhu, kelembapan, dan deskripsi cuaca
  • Ikon cuaca yang berubah sesuai kondisi
  • Background dinamis (misalnya background mendung pas cuaca mendung)

Project ini cocok untuk kamu yang mau belajar asynchronous JavaScript dengan fetch atau async/await. Kalau sudah mahir, kamu bisa lanjut bikin versi mobile-nya dengan React Native atau Flutter.

5. Game Tebak Angka (Dengan Level Kesulitan)

Siapa bilang belajar coding harus serius terus? Bikin game kecil kayak tebak angka bisa jadi hiburan sekaligus latihan logika.

Ide sederhananya begini:

  • Komputer memilih angka acak antara 1-100
  • User menebak dan diberi petunjuk “Terlalu besar” atau “Terlalu kecil”
  • Hitung jumlah percobaan dan tampilkan skor
  • Tambahkan level kesulitan (easy: 1–50, medium: 1–100, hard: 1–200)

Dengan tambahan suara dan animasi kecil, game ini bisa jadi sangat menyenangkan. Kalau mau lebih kompleks, tambahkan leaderboard lokal atau fitur multiplayer sederhana via WebSocket!

Bonus Tips: Upload ke GitHub & Pamerkan!

Apapun project yang kamu buat, jangan biarkan nganggur di folder laptop. Upload ke GitHub! Tulis README yang rapi, kasih penjelasan singkat tentang projectmu, dan kalau bisa, deploy langsung ke Netlify, Vercel, atau GitHub Pages. Jadi, kalau ada HRD atau klien ngintip, kamu udah siap pamer hasil karya.

Penutup

Jadi, kapan terakhir kali kamu gabut tapi produktif? Mulai sekarang, setiap kali merasa bosan, buka laptop dan mulai satu project kecil. Nggak harus sempurna, yang penting mulai dulu. Lama-lama kamu akan kaget sendiri dengan seberapa banyak skill yang kamu kuasai cuma dari ngoding iseng-iseng.

Semoga ide-ide project di atas bisa jadi inspirasi ya! Jangan lupa share artikel ini ke teman-temanmu yang suka ngoding biar gabutnya juga bermanfaat 😄

Sampai ketemu di artikel selanjutnya. Tetap semangat belajar dan ngoding! 👨‍💻👩‍💻

Leave a Reply

Your email address will not be published. Required fields are marked *

You might also like